Go out and see the world. Viva Macau: Senado Square. November 19, 2014. November 20, 2014. Fondle the Mediterranean atmosphere as you walk through the paved town square that has stood for centuries. Labeled as the heart of Macau, Senado Square. Largo de Senado in Portuguese). Has been one of the most prominent landmarks in this former Portuguese colony. The famed square was also part of the Historic Centre of Macau,. Which is included in UNESCO World Heritage List. When we visited Macau. The next morning...

Taking your mind for a walk through the storm. Walking along the beach I am drawn in by the ocean, taken by its endless power, its lolling motion, its intriguing mystery and violent beauty. It doesn’t possess the reassuring magic of forests nor the sense of possibility I feel beside rivers but from the air above the ocean I experience a cleansing lightness that is not dissimilar to my experiences atop crisp mountains or sitting alone in a sauna. My exploration for truth, connection and growth comes down ...

Exploring the world through the lens of my iPhone. Olloclip Lens for iPhone4/4s. One of my most used apps to edit my photos on my iPhone is Snapseed. Below I’ll show some screen shots and explain a little more in detail the uses of Snapseed. Selective adjust allows the user to make fine adjustments to portions of the image versus the whole image. If you’ve made an adjustment and want to know what difference it made, you can tap the small picture in the upper right hand corner. It will temporari...Once yo...
